New starter first day — evacuation-chair store: Walk the new starter to the evacuation-chair store beside Stairwell B on Level 1 of Harlowe House. Show them the two Pellagrin chairs, the quick-release straps, and the inspection log on the inside of the door. Confirm they can identify the nearest assembly point. The store door is locked at all times and opens with the pass below.

turnstile pass: bdg-NG-3

- [ ] Prototype workshop orientation (Day 1): Walk the new starter to the Oakhurst Annexe, ground floor. Confirm they have signed the tool-safety sheet and collected safety glasses from the rack by the door. Introduce them to the duty technician if present. The workshop door stays locked; have them enter using the code below.

staff pass of kagup-fajog = bdg-QCHVQW-99665837

**Q: How do I get into the Fabrel Prototype Workshop after 22:00?**

Main badge readers go offline at 22:00. Night shift uses the side door off Corridor D only. Do not prop the door; the alarm triggers after 40 seconds. Log your entry in the wall binder. Machines stay powered down unless cleared by the shift lead. Use the code below at the keypad.

badge for hahif-faweg: bdg-VF-9

## Idempotency Keys for Payment Retries (Lumopay)

Every retry of a charge request must reuse the original idempotency key; generating a new key on retry can produce duplicate charges. Keys are scoped per merchant and expire after 48 hours. Reviewers should verify keys are derived server-side, never from client input. The full key-generation specification and threat model are maintained on the internal page.

dashboard of kaguf-tawip = https://vault.merlaqsys.test/issue